C-Reactive Protein Calibrator Set
The C-Reactive Protein Calibrator Set is prepared by diluting human serum with C-reactive protein and adding sodium azide (< 0.1%) as a stabilizer. This ensures the stability and accuracy of the calibrator for diagnostic purposes.
Product English Name:
C-Reactive Protein Calibrator Set
Alias:
CRP Calibrator,CRP Standard
Intended Use:
This calibrator is used for the in vitro quantitative determination of C-reactive protein in human serum or plasma. It is essential for calibrating CRP assays to ensure accurate and reliable diagnostic results.

 Precautions

Proper handling and storage of the C-Reactive Protein Calibrator Set are essential to maintain its stability and ensure accurate results. This section outlines key precautions to follow.

1. Storage Conditions: The calibrator should be stored at the recommended temperature to maintain its stability and effectiveness.
2. Handling Procedures: Proper handling techniques should be followed to avoid contamination and ensure the integrity of the calibrator.
3. Expiration Date: Always check the expiration date before use, as expired calibrators may not provide accurate results.
4. Safety Measures: Sodium azide, used as a stabilizer, is toxic and should be handled with care. Follow all safety guidelines to avoid exposure.
5. Quality Control: Regularly perform quality control checks to ensure the calibrator is functioning as expected and providing accurate results.
